From 612a43dedd7fdfc0dd69f22791400540c3a06784 Mon Sep 17 00:00:00 2001 From: Satana Charuwichitratana Date: Fri, 1 Jul 2022 00:24:51 +0700 Subject: [PATCH 1/2] fix(auth): Missing type in configure function --- packages/auth/src/Auth.ts | 2 +- packages/auth/src/types/Auth.ts | 1 + 2 files changed, 2 insertions(+), 1 deletion(-) diff --git a/packages/auth/src/Auth.ts b/packages/auth/src/Auth.ts index e82cc8fb301..a3c277813ab 100644 --- a/packages/auth/src/Auth.ts +++ b/packages/auth/src/Auth.ts @@ -139,7 +139,7 @@ export class AuthClass { return 'Auth'; } - configure(config?) { + configure(config?: AuthOptions) { if (!config) return this._config || {}; logger.debug('configure Auth'); const conf = Object.assign( diff --git a/packages/auth/src/types/Auth.ts b/packages/auth/src/types/Auth.ts index 17d0d440852..c14650047ef 100644 --- a/packages/auth/src/types/Auth.ts +++ b/packages/auth/src/types/Auth.ts @@ -50,6 +50,7 @@ export interface AuthOptions { identityPoolRegion?: string; clientMetadata?: any; endpoint?: string; + ssr?: boolean; } export enum CognitoHostedUIIdentityProvider { From fced7103289ac80a7634e7ec08bc7b5b12165980 Mon Sep 17 00:00:00 2001 From: Satana Charuwichitratana Date: Fri, 1 Jul 2022 00:43:38 +0700 Subject: [PATCH 2/2] docs: Update config type for configure function --- docs/api/classes/authclass.html |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/docs/api/classes/authclass.html b/docs/api/classes/authclass.html index c2f4a0a1d63..d68d231ba2c 100644 --- a/docs/api/classes/authclass.html +++ b/docs/api/classes/authclass.html @@ -1287,7 +1287,7 @@

Returns Promise

configure

  • @@ -2709,4 +2709,4 @@

    Legend

    gtag('config', 'UA-115615468-1'); - \ No newline at end of file +